Official: UK retailer buys out Strand Centre
It's official - another major UK retailer is coming to the Island.
The Strand Shopping Centre in Douglas has confirmed today it's been bought out by Sports Direct.
The 40,000 square-foot complex has been purchased from former owner Brian J Eaton Ltd, for an undisclosed sum.
It's believed Sports Direct, which operates around 670 stores worldwide, has plans to regenerate the centre, in addition to opening its own branch spanning 'multiple' retail units.
